2. Probiotics - Probiotics are beneficial bacteria that live in the digestive system. They help to maintain a healthy balance of gut bacteria, which in turn can improve your cat's overall immunity. You can find probiotic supplements specifically formulated for cats at your local pet store.
3. Omega-3 Fatty Acids - Omega-3 fatty acids are essential for supporting a cat's immune system. They have anti-inflammatory properties and can help reduce the risk of chronic illnesses. You can add omega-3 fatty acids to your cat's diet through fish oil supplements or by giving them small portions of cooked fish, such as salmon or tuna.

5. Exercise - Just like humans, cats need regular exercise to stay healthy. A good workout can improve their immune system, help maintain a healthy weight, and reduce stress levels. Make sure to provide your cat with plenty of toys to play with, and set aside time each day for some active playtime.
